The lock is on the Berkshire bank between Aston and Remenham. Built by the Thames Navigation Commission in 1773, the lock is named after the village of Hambleden, a mile (1.5 km) to the north.

There are records of a lock here from the early 1400s. It was a flash lock right up until 1773, with two mills, one on each side of the river. On the Berkshire bank were two corn mills, and on …

Mill End consists of 32 houses, some on the river bank and others on the northern side of the main road. The largest historic home is at the heart of its cluster of buildings, Yewden Manor, listed grade II for architecture.
